Program areas at VAC
Program support services This program enables VAC to supplement its other programs to provide patients in need with prescription drugs at reduced costs and medical services at little or no cost.
Education Programs designed to educate and provide the public and patients with ready access to practical and current treatment information so that they may provide quality care to people living with HIV/AIDS.
Health care assistance Programs designed to improve and protect the ability to provide high-quality and comprehensive, and compassionate health care for all patients living with HIV/AIDS and includes preventative exams and care for chronic and urgent health issues.
VAC provides various housing services to persons in the community living with HIV. the services offered include, assistance with utility, rental, mortgage, long term rental, security deposit, and emergency hotel stays and transitional housing for homeless individuals.

Financials for VAC
| Revenues | FYE 08/2024 | FYE 08/2023 | % Change |
|---|
| Total grants, contributions, etc. | $17,386,685 | $25,010,115 | -30.5% |
| Program services | $0 | $0 | - |
| Investment income and dividends | $56,349 | $0 | 999% |
| Tax-exempt bond proceeds | $0 | $0 | - |
| Royalty revenue | $0 | $0 | - |
| Net rental income | $0 | $0 | - |
| Net gain from sale of non-inventory assets | $0 | $0 | - |
| Net income from fundraising events | $0 | $0 | - |
| Net income from gaming activities | $0 | $0 | - |
| Net income from sales of inventory | $0 | $0 | - |
| Miscellaneous revenues | $0 | $0 | - |
| Total revenues | $17,443,034 | $25,010,115 | -30.3% |
